About the Role
We are looking for a highly motivated Full Stack GoLang Developer with 4+ years of experience to take end-to-end ownership of our platform's development and enhancement. The ideal candidate should be capable of independently handling frontend and backend development, database design, API integrations, deployment, and ongoing maintenance while collaborating closely with stakeholders to deliver scalable and high-quality solutions.
Key Responsibilities
- Take end-to-end ownership of feature development from requirement gathering, solution design, development, testing, deployment, and production support.
- Develop and maintain scalable backend services using GoLang.
- Design, build, and integrate RESTful APIs and microservices.
- Develop responsive and user-friendly frontend applications using modern JavaScript frameworks.
- Collaborate with product and business teams to understand requirements and translate them into technical solutions.
- Optimize application performance, scalability, security, and reliability.
- Design and maintain database schemas and ensure data integrity.
- Troubleshoot, debug, and resolve production issues.
- Participate in code reviews and contribute to best practices and coding standards.
- Ensure seamless integration between frontend, backend, and third-party services.
Required SkillsBackend
- Strong experience with GoLang.
- Experience building REST APIs and microservices.
- Strong understanding of concurrency, goroutines, and channels.
- Experience with authentication and authorization (JWT, OAuth).
- Experience with Redis and caching strategies.
- Understanding of scalable application architecture.
Frontend
- Strong experience with React.js.
- Experience with TypeScript, JavaScript, HTML5, and CSS3.
- Experience integrating frontend applications with backend APIs.
- Understanding of responsive design and frontend performance optimization.
Database
- Strong experience with PostgreSQL and/or MySQL.
- Experience with database design, indexing, and query optimization.
- Exposure to NoSQL databases is an advantage.
DevOps & Cloud
- Git and version control best practices.
- Docker and containerized deployments.
- CI/CD pipeline experience.
- Experience with AWS, Azure, or Google Cloud.
- Kubernetes knowledge is a plus.
Experience
- 4+ years of Full Stack Development experience.
- Minimum 2+ years of hands-on GoLang development experience.
- Proven experience owning applications end-to-end.
Pay: ₹300,000.00 - ₹600,000.00 per year
Application Question(s):
- Please apply only if your an immediate joiner.
Experience:
- Golang: 2 years (Required)
- Back-end development: 4 years (Preferred)
Work Location: In person